    • Sales Manager Distribution Channels in the USA
      Jan 2008 - Dec 2008 · 1 yr

      Accountable for elevating 50 new distribution channels (comprising 500 sales professionals) from ground zero to a multimillion-dollar success story, currently responsible for over 20% of total sales. Traveled nearly all states of the USA, building the sales organization, visiting customers, providing training to distributors. It was a valuable opportunity to gain insights into the workings of the North American sales landscape. We had to overcome two significant challenges: our brand's absolute obscurity in the market and the fact that the channels initially opening doors for us were mechanical distributors, rather than electrical. This necessitated the creation of innovative training methods for these mechanical distributors to effectively sell electrical products and the development of marketing strategies to establish our presence in the market. Pioneered a novel sales concept named the "Scanning System," designed to guide salespeople from opportunity development and quoting through to the closing stage. Salespeople, many of whom had limited knowledge of electrical machine wiring, emerged equipped with a comprehensive understanding of installation concepts for machines (wiring concepts).This innovative approach significantly propelled the sales of fieldbus systems.
